We need … Web3 nov. 2024 · To calculate pulse pressure, simply subtract your systolic blood pressure (top number) from your diastolic blood pressure (bottom number). Like blood pressure, it is measured in millimeters of mercury (mmHg). For example, if your blood pressure is 120/80 mmHg, your pulse pressure is 40 mmHg (120 – 80). Web27 jul. 2024 · Multiply your daily calorie intake by 20 to 35 percent to calculate your recommended daily intake of fats. Divide the answer by 9 to convert from calories to grams. In the example, determine the fat portion by multiplying 2,000 by 0.25, yielding 500 calories, and divide that number by 9 to result in approximately 55.5 g of fats. Multiply your ...

Web7 jan. 2024 · All we need to do is find the difference between the largest data value in our set and the smallest data value. Stated succinctly we have the following formula: Range = Maximum Value–Minimum Value. For example, the data set 4,6,10, 15, 18 has a maximum of 18, a minimum of 4 and a range of 18-4 = 14 . Clinical formulas for calculation of SBP and MAP (mm Hg) in normal children are as follows: SBP (5th percentile at 50th height percentile) = 2 x age in years ... race type cobbyhttp://www.clinlabnavigator.com/reference-ranges.html shoe inserts 1 inchWeb31 mrt. 2024 · The % Tolerance is calculated as: the: acceptable variation ÷ target weight value X 100. For example, if the acceptable variation =2g and the target weight value =100g, then the tolerance =2% and a weight measurement of 98g to 102g is acceptable.
